Job Summary

Design complex underground piping projects in urban and rural environments in compliance with client's engineering and construction specifications, field engineering of project requirements, identification of conflicting utilities, engineering and design calculations, and work permit development.


Responsibilities

Job Responsibilities

  • Work with Lead Engineer to complete gas engineering projects including calculations, design & constructability reviews, work procedures and Bill of Materials.
  • Setting and maintaining technical practices
  • Work with complex CAD software to draft products and specialized equipment to create utility systems.
  • Prioritize tasks, establish and adhere to deadlines, and create timelines for work completion.
  • Excellent organizational, time management, and communication skills as well as the ability to adapt to change.
  • Ability to collaborate with engineers, designers, supervisors, financial experts, and project team members.
  • Researches and implements design improvements.
  • Create solutions and make necessary modifications to existing systems.
  • Provide quality control and documentation for processes.
  • Demonstrated commitment to safety throughout a project’s lifespan.

Qualifications

Minimum Qualifications

  • Bachelor of Science in Engineering
  • Computer proficient including AutoCAD, Adobe and MS Office.
  • EIT or PE license a plus
  • Experience in Gas Design a plus

Physical Demands and Work Environment

This job operates in a field environment. This role routinely requires extended periods of bending, squatting, climbing, kneeling, pushing, pulling, lifting, lifting in awkward positions, standing, and twisting. Also, working in inclement weather conditions, such as extreme heat, extreme cold, rain, ice, snow, and wind.

The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of the job. This position is physically active, with lifting required. Must be able to bend and lift and carry up to 50 pounds. Clarity of vision at 20 feet or more or 20 inches or less, with the ability to judge distance and space relationships. Precise hand-eye coordination. Ability to identify and distinguish colors.
